This AC/DC power supply delivers a stable 24 V DC output for reliable low-voltage systems, operating from 220 V - 240 V input. It supports consistent performance with a PF of 0,95 and features robust protection for dependable integration.
This unit is a compact AC/DC power supply designed to convert mains input into a stable low-voltage output for control and auxiliary circuits. It operates from a 220 V - 240 V feed and provides a regulated 24 V DC output suitable for technical systems that require consistent supply conditions. With a PF of 0,95, it optimises electrical performance in installations where power quality matters, helping reduce reactive effects in the upstream network.
The enclosure is made from PC, a durable thermoplastic chosen for electrical insulation and lightweight integration into panels and devices. Its working envelope spans from -30 °C to +50 °C, supporting operational stability in varied ambient conditions. The product carries CE and RoHS certifications, aligning with common compliance needs in projects. As an indoor component, it integrates cleanly into technical assemblies without unnecessary bulk, providing a dependable backbone for low-voltage distribution.

Input: 220 V - 240 V; Output: 24 V DC; Power Factor: 0,95; Working temperature: -30 °C a +50 °C.
Install the unit in indoor electrical assemblies according to the indicated installation system, ensuring appropriate ventilation and correct polarity on the 24 V DC output. Use suitable cable sizing and secure terminations to maintain electrical safety and reliable connection. Verify upstream protection and isolation before energising to protect the power supply and downstream equipment.
Periodic checks of tightening and visual inspection help preserve stable operation over time. Disconnect the power supply before any intervention.
